摘要
内秦淮河(玄武段)逸仙桥断面属于水质考核市控断面,当前水质为劣Ⅴ类,2020年目标为Ⅴ类。本文通过周边水系调查、污染源强解析的途径,分析出逸仙桥断面水质超标主要原因为雨污分流尚未全部完成,玄武湖补水不足、内源和降雨径流污染,并进行污染源削减和生态补水水质达标方案分析,提出了针对性较强的对策,为地方环保管理部门提供技术支撑,这对改善秦淮河流域水环境具有十分重要的意义。
        The section of Yixian Bridge in the Inner Qinhuai River(Xuanwu Section) belongs to the municipal control section of water quality assessment. The current water quality is inferior to Category V, and the target for 2020 is Class V. In this paper, through the investigation of surrounding water system and the analysis of strong pollution sources, the main reason for the water quality of the section of Yixian Bridge is that the rainwater and sewage diversion has not been completed, and the Xuanwu Lake has insufficient water supply, endogenous and rainfall runoff pollution. The pollution source reduction and ecological hydration water quality compliance plan analysis were carried out, and the targeted countermeasures were put forward to provide technical support for the local environmental protection management department, which is of great significance for improving the water environment of the Qinhuai River Basin.
